What determines the length of time that syslog is retained by Ciscoworks? We have a requirement to keep logs for 1 year, but only seem to have 2 months. The server has over 60 GB of free space, so there must be a config setting somewhere?

Hi.
Check
RME-->Administration-->Syslog-->Set Purge Policy

Joseph,
The purge was set correctly for 365 days. Any ideas on how to determine why we only have 2 months. We did upgrade to 2.6 a couple months ago, would that purge all syslog?
Dave
09-28-2007 09:55 AM
Hi Dave,
What did you upgrade *from*? Did you do the 2.5 -->2.5.1-->2.6 upgrade? Also, when you did the upgrade, did you do a data migration in accordance with:
?
If not, then yes, definitely this would explain the lack of syslog messages from the time prior to the upgrade.
